Output 03180653b0ee5af161c141baa0a17497d9c1ebc059a77f7a2aba0a1ce00ceb97:0

value
18214670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a92c56f1b9650196c411647038db8f86f86cc2ba OP_EQUAL
address
3H7XEjYUxJUVRk2vfU4KAkBLihgX8SCWBT
transaction
03180653b0ee5af161c141baa0a17497d9c1ebc059a77f7a2aba0a1ce00ceb97
spent
true